Output 264c67b05f54816798c143db8eda23eeaa5f13b0f7d09f236d2893c20f21d21f:0

value
299996952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bb7905e79ce70b475ec50104df4faabe292012 OP_EQUAL
address
3MuRqmnoCuCC6My8d6TAMpYzjSEDT1QtUR
transaction
264c67b05f54816798c143db8eda23eeaa5f13b0f7d09f236d2893c20f21d21f
spent
true